Chris Stratton traded by Giants to Angels for reliever Williams Jerez

SAN FRANCISCO -- The Giants finished their exhibition game well after 11 p.m. on Monday night. They weren't done for the day.

One minute before midnight, the Giants announced that they traded right-hander Chris Stratton to the Angels in exchange for left-handed reliever Williams Jerez. In a related move, lefty Andrew Suarez was optioned to Triple-A, all but setting the rotation.

Asked after the game if he had an order of starting pitchers, manager Bruce Bochy was coy.

"You'll see why here soon," Bochy said.

A few minutes later the Giants announced they have parted ways with a former first-round pick who seemed headed for the long reliever role.
